The term for the function being integrated in ∫f(x) dx is called:
- A. Integral
- B. Integrand
- C. Constant of integration
- D. Differential coefficient
Answer: B) Integrand
Explanation: In the notation ∫f(x) dx, f(x) is called the integrand, ∫ is the integral sign, and dx indicates the variable of integration.
